Whole Wheat Paneer Kulcha (Healthy Stuffed Kulcha Recipe Without Oven)

Whole wheat paneer kulcha is a healthier version of the classic stuffed kulcha made with atta instead of refined flour. This easy recipe shows how to make soft and flavorful paneer kulcha without oven using a simple tawa method.

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Resting Time 10 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ings 6 small kulchas
Calories 370kcal
Author Srivalli

Ingredients

For the Kulchas:

  • 2 cups Wheat Flour
  • 1/4 cup Milk
  • 1/4 cup Curds / Yogurt
  • 1 tsp Ba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p Baking Soda
  • Salt to taste
  • 2 tbsp Cooking Oil

For Paneer stuffing:

  • 1.5 cups Paneer grated
  • 1 tsp Red chili powder
  • 1/4 tsp Cumin powder
  • 1 tsp Garam Masala powder
  • Coriander leaves handful finely chopped
  • Salt to taste

Instructions

Preparing the dough:

  • In a wide bowl, sieve the flour along with baking powder, baking soda. Add salt, curds and mise well.
  • Gradually add the milk to knead a soft pliable dough.
  • Knead it for some 5 minutes until the dough becomes very soft.
  • Cover with a cloth and let it rest for 10 minutes.

Preparing the paneer stuffing for the healthy kulcha

  • Grate the paneer in a bowl, add the red chili powder, cumin powder, salt, garam masala, and coriander leaves.
  • Mix everything well. Divide into small sized balls.

Making the stuffed kulcha

  • Divide the dough into equal balls. Take one ball, keep rest covered.
  • Flatten the balls on the sides, keeping the center thicker.
  • Place the filling in the center, gather from the sides and fold it well to enclose the ball fully.
  • Dust dry flour and gently roll out a disc keep it on a thicker side.
  • Heat a nonstick pan, grease with oil, and cook the kulchas on both sides.
  • Serve with curds and pickle of choice.
